    First off the view is amazing and seating options are great. You can choose from couches or tables and chairs or the bar. We started with the pimento cheese appetizer. We thought it could've been so much better, it was bland and saltine crackers were not special. The chicken sandwich and fries was good. The appetizer that was chicken fingers with cheese and sauces on top was not good. The chicken looked like it had been cooked twice but still wasn't hot. The short rib sandwich, which our server said was her favorite was not edible. It was so tough you couldn't chew it. They must have different people cooking and some have no idea what they're doing. There was a manager walking around but he was moving so quickly we couldn't engage with him to say what we thought. In conclusion the atmosphere is fantastic but the food lacks in many of their dishes.

    My dad is an Air Force veteran. At 83, he still loves to watch planes take off and land - he finds it beautiful and calming. So when we told him about BNA Sky Pavilion at the Hilton Nashville Airport, his eyes lit up. We had dinner there during sunset the other night, and he loved it so much it made me tear up. The views from the floor-to-ceiling windows are breathtaking, and watching the planes load up and take off or land peacefully in Nashville was an experience together that we'll really remember. Great food and drinks, unbelievable family memory.
